Most of the daysails take a maximum of 6 passengers. We had 6 in our family, so were the only passengers with Capt. Bobby and Mate Karen. The charge for us was $115 cash or $125 credit card or travelers checks per person.

This was one of the best times I have ever had. All six of us will be going back. The cost is $115 Cash per person. We all bought a tee shirt for $20. The way it worked out with us is, each couple gave $300. You will see how hard Karen works and you will want tip. For $150 a person for a full day of sailing and a gourmet lunch, you can't beat it. I have heard great things about Rumbaba and can't wait! The way I feel is if you do the excursion from the cruise lines, there any where from $50 and higher for 4 hours. No food, limited to drink and you only snorkle for about 20 minutes with about 75 to 100 people.
